[bitbake-devel] [1.44 07/25] runqueue: Batch scenequeue updates

Batch all updates to scenequeue data together in a single invocation
instead of checking each task serially. This allows the checks for
sstate object to happen in parallel, and also makes sure the log
statement only happens once (per set of rehashes).
